How fast is 0-60 in F1
roughly 2.6 seconds
F1 cars accelerate from 0 – 60mph in roughly 2.6 seconds. This might seem slow given their top speed, however as a lot of their speed comes from the aerodynamics (which works better the quicker the car is going), they can't unleash full power from a standing start.

What is considered a slow 0-60
For a non-sporty car that just needs to keep up with traffic and be easy to drive, anything under 10 seconds is perfectly adequate. For a car to be considered somewhat sporty or exciting, I'd say the 0–60 time has to be under 7 seconds or so.

What is the fastest 0-60 car
Fastest accelerating cars: full listRimac Nevera – 1.85 seconds (0-60mph)Lucid Air Sapphire – 1.89 seconds (0-60mph)Pininfarina Battista – 1.9 seconds (0-62mph)Tesla Model S Plaid – 2.3 seconds (0-60mph)Ultima Evolution Coupe (supercharged) & Ultima RS LT5 – 2.3 seconds (0-60mph)
